Program Director - School Age Child Care

Seeking highly motivated, organized, compassionate individuals to lead multiple school aged childcare sites. 
Job Description

This position supports the work of the Y, a leading nonprofit, charitable organization committed to strengthening community through youth development, healthy living and social responsibility. Under the supervision of the Senior Director, this person is responsible for honest, efficient, timely, and accurate accomplishment of the responsibilities of this position.

Qualifications

1. Bachelor's degree in related field or equivalent. 

2. One to two years related experience preferred. 

3. Must be 21 years or older. 

4. Completion of YMCA-Specific Certifications must be achieved within 30 days of hire. 

5. Ability to related effectively to diverse groups of people from all social and economic segments of the community. 

6. Within 30 days of hire, must complete Child Abuse Prevention Training, CPR, First Aid, AED and Blood Borne Pathogens trainings. 

Essential Functions

1. Directs and supervises program activities to meet the needs of the community and fulfill YMCA objectives. 

2. Recruits, hires, trains, develops, schedules, and directs childcare staff as needed. Reviews and evaluates staff performance. Develops strategies to motive staff and achieve goals. 

3. Establishes new program activities and expands program within the community in accordance with strategic and operating plans. 

4. Assists in the marketing and distribution of program information, and may organize and schedule program registrations. May review and process program scholarship applications. 

5. Develops and maintains collaborative relationships with community partners and organizations. 

6. Develops and monitors program budget to meet fiscal objectives. 

7. Coordinates use of facilities for program activities and events. 

8. Assists in YMCA fundraising activities and special events. 

9. Models relationship-building skills in all interactions. Responds to all member and community inquiries and complaints in a timely manner. 

10. Compiles program statistics. Monitors and evaluates the effectiveness of and participation in programs. 

11. May assist with Program Committee Meetings. 

12. Performs other duties as assigned.
